Do Porches Require Planning Permission? You probably won't need planning permission to build a porch on the front entrance to your property in Ludlow if: your dwelling is a house, not a maisonette, flat or other kind of building, no component of the porch construction is within 2 metres from the boundary of the property or within two metres of any highway, no component of the porch construction is over three metres above ground level, the porch does not exceed a ground area of 3 square metres.

It is always better to shoot down to your local planning office before pressing ahead with your porch. Your preferred Ludlow porch builder will perhaps even do this for you. You should always be sure when it comes to planning permission.

Building Regulations Relating to Porch Building: You should keep in mind that planning permission and building regulations approval are 2 different things. You shouldn't need building regulations approval if the following are true: all disabled access is maintained, the porch construction is less than 30m2 and is at ground level and the present external door stays in place. Building regulations approval is invariably needed for certain windows and all electrical installations.

What are the Benefits? There are a number of benefits that having a porch brings, including: additional storage space, providing somewhere to stand umbrellas, hang coats and leave muddy shoes, boosting the overall value of your house, offering a place to leave a bicycle, enhancing the property's appeal to prospective buyers should you need to put it on the market, reducing heat loss through your front door, giving extra character to a currently plain doorway and an extra deterrent to burglars.

Lean-To Porch

A lean-to porch is a porch featuring a forward sloping roof that can be designed to complement the roof of your home in Ludlow, or blend in with an existing awning. Lean-to porches are an effective, yet comparatively low-cost way to improve the look of your property. A totally enclosed lean-to porch can save on energy bills by providing heat insulation to your front entryway, add a supplementary level of security, provide shade from the sun and create a handy extra room for keeping hats, shoes and coats.

Lean-to porches are one of the easiest ways to extend you home, either to the rear, front or side. Depending on your needs, a lean-to porch can be open to the elements, partly enclosed or fully enclosed. In reality they can be as simple as an inclined roof held up by 4 (or even 2) wooden posts. These days, you can even buy lean-to porch kits, if you fancy trying out your do-it-yourself capabilities. Although, employing a local Ludlow porch builder may be the more sensible option.

Overdoor/Porch Canopies Ludlow

Roof-like structures, identified as overdoor or porch canopies, are commonly affixed to the outside wall above an entrance or doorway. The beauty of overdoor and porch canopies lies in their customisability. From material choices like polycarbonate, wood or metal to a range of sizes and styles, you can design a canopy that blends seamlessly with your property's architecture and provides the type of cover you require.

Overdoor/Porch Canopies Ludlow

Benefits of Overdoor Canopies:

  1. Enhanced Kerb Appeal: A thoughtfully chosen canopy does far more than simply offer protection - it redefines your property's kerb appeal. By elegantly framing your entrance, it becomes a visual focal point, drawing the eye and creating a more welcoming setting.
  2. Sun Protection: Offering protection from the intense UV rays of the sun, canopies prevent your door, particularly wooden ones, from warping and fading. They also provide necessary shade for you and your guests on hot days, avoiding discomfort while the door is being unlocked.
  3. Protection from the Weather: Sheltering your porch and doorway area from hail, snow and rain, canopies prevent these areas from becoming slippy and hazardous. This safeguards you and your visitors, maintaining dryness upon exiting or entering your property, most notably in harsh weather.
  4. A Reduction in Maintenance: Overdoor canopies help shield your doorway from snow and rain, reducing the need for routine cleaning. They can also protect your door from grime, leaves, and other debris, extending its longevity.
  5. Better Security: Potential criminals are deterred by a well-lit porch canopy that lights up the entrance, making the space less appealing for those prowling around at night.
  6. Shelter for Deliveries and Packages: The covered area provided by overdoor canopies ensures that deliveries and parcels are protected against damage from snow or rain.

The Federation of Master Builders

In the UK's construction industry, the Federation of Master Builders (FMB) is highly regarded as a trade body. It serves as a platform for professional builders, advocating for high standards of integrity, craftsmanship and customer service. To become FMB members, individuals must undergo an exacting vetting process and commit to adhering to a strict Code of Practice. By providing support and resources, the FMB assists its members in staying up-to-date with industry best practices and regulations. The professionalism and expertise of FMB members provide homeowners in Ludlow with confidence when hired. The FMB's offerings include a dispute resolution service, ensuring the resolution of any issues that may arise during a construction project.

Since its founding in July 1941, the Federation of Master Builders has progressed into a reputable trade body, standing for a multitude of professionals and construction businesses across the UK.
